Can you engrave glass with Cricut Maker?

Can the Cricut Maker Engrave Glass? No. At this time, the Cricut Maker Engraving Tip is not designed to be used with glass. You can, however, use your Cricut machine to create a stencil and etch the glass using glass etching cream.

What do you need for glass etching with Cricut?

You'll need the following for this project:
  1. Wine glass (or other glass base you want to use)*
  2. Isopropyl alcohol (aka: rubbing alcohol)
  3. Etching cream such as Armour Etch.
  4. Vinyl and transfer tape.
  5. Small paint brush.
  6. Protective gloves and eyewear.
  7. Masking tape (or painter's tape)
  8. Cricut machine+ to create stencil.

What can you engrave with Cricut Maker?

The Cricut Maker engraving tool is supposed to work with soft metals, acrylics, plastics, and leathers, so we found as many different types of these materials to test as possible! Now it's important to note that the engraving tool does not engrave very deeply, nor does it fill in any voids.

What is the best vinyl to use for glass etching?

Permanent vinyl takes 72 hours to cure so you do not run the risk of having an issue getting it off the glass when you are done etching. I use Cricut Permanent Vinyl or Oracal 651 Outdoor vinyl. Cricut also has flexible Cricut vinyl stencil.

Why is my glass not etching?

Any debris or tiny pecks of dust can hinder the etching process because the etching cream, will not etch evenly. Wipe everything off with a slightly dampened, soft paper towel. Hold the glass up to a bright light—this can reveal anything debris you have missed.

How thick can the Cricut Maker engrave?

You can use the Engraving Tool to engrave a wide variety of materials up to 11″ wide. Cricut recommends engraving materials that are no more than 3/32″ thick (2.4 mm), however, we have had success with items up to 1/8″ thick provided that they are still able to fit under the roller bar of the Maker.

Can a Cricut Maker engrave wood?

What type of wood should you use? The Cricut Maker can cut basswood, balsa wood, as well as wood veneer. I recommend the basswood for this project as it is a stronger wood and works best for engraving.
